ZIP code 24934 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Dunmore, Pocahontas County, West Virginia, home to just 503 residents across 167.7 square miles, a density of 3 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.
ZIP 24934 reports a modest median household income of $40,301 (30% below the average West Virginia ZIP), while per-capita income is $25,135. Economic pressure is pronounced: 24.6% of residents are below the poverty line and unemployment is 10.6%. Housing is both higher-cost and owner-heavy: median home value is $231,100 (67% above the average West Virginia ZIP), while 85.6% of occupied homes are owner-occupied.
A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 30.2%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 61.1, and the average commute is -.
